首页前端开发JavaScriptjavascript 地图 api

javascript 地图 api

时间2023-10-27 20:13:02发布访客分类JavaScript浏览1102
导读:JavaScript 地图 API 是一种将地图数据呈现在网页上的工具。这种 API 通常是由第三方地图提供商提供的,并且可以用于在您的网站上显示任何地理位置相关的信息或活动。下面我们来详细了解一下 JavaScript 地图 API。首先...
JavaScript 地图 API 是一种将地图数据呈现在网页上的工具。这种 API 通常是由第三方地图提供商提供的,并且可以用于在您的网站上显示任何地理位置相关的信息或活动。下面我们来详细了解一下 JavaScript 地图 API。首先,我们重点介绍 Google Maps JavaScript API。它是一个可引入的 JavaScript 库,该库可让您通过 JavaScript 代码轻松地将地图集成到网页中。例如,以下代码可以把一个地图从 Google Maps API 显示在网页中:
function initMap() {
var map = new google.maps.Map(document.getElementById('map'), {
zoom: 8,center: {
lat: 37.7749, lng: -122.4194}
}
    );
}
这个示例创建了一个新的 Google 地图,并将其显示在具有 id “map” 的 HTML 元素上。注意,在初始化函数中,我们可以设置许多选项来调整地图的属性,如放大级别(zoom)和中心中的经纬度(center)。此外,几乎所有的 JavaScript 地图 API 都提供了一大堆功能,用于在地图上添加标记、信息窗口、自定义样式和热区,以及响应地图上的交互动作(如滚轮缩放和拖动)。例如,以下代码在某个经纬度处设置了一个标记,当用户单击标记时,会弹出一个信息窗口来显示更多的信息:
function initMap() {
var myLatLng = {
lat: 37.7749, lng: -122.4194}
    ;
var map = new google.maps.Map(document.getElementById('map'), {
zoom: 8,center: myLatLng}
    );
var marker = new google.maps.Marker({
position: myLatLng,map: map,title: 'San Francisco'}
    );
var infowindow = new google.maps.InfoWindow({
content: '

San Francisco

This is a beautiful city!

'} ); marker.addListener('click', function() { infowindow.open(map, marker); } ); }
这个示例创建了一个带有标题 “San Francisco” 的标记,并将其放置在某个特定位置。当用户单击标记时,一个信息窗口弹出,内容是一个标题和一些描述性文本。此外,我们还有一个事件监听器,以便在点击标记时打开信息窗口。最后,JavaScript 地图 API 还可以集成与其他 Google 服务的数据,如 Google Places API,这样您就可以轻松地将一些搜索、预测和推荐功能整合到您的应用程序中。例如,您可以使用 Google Places API 查找在地图中附近的医院和餐馆,并显示到您的用户上。总之,JavaScript 地图 API 是一种令人兴奋和强大的工具,可用于将地图和地理位置相关的数据集成到您的网站或应用程序中。通过与其他应用程序和服务集成,使地图更加的有生命力,同时还可以领先于竞争对手。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: javascript 地图 api
本文地址: https://pptw.com/jishu/513531.html
javascript 回车提交表单 javascript 地址传递

游客 回复需填写必要信息